Sport
La Trobe has extensive sports facilities at our two largest campuses. They include an indoor swimming pool, rock-climbing and abseiling facilities, tennis courts, indoor field house, sports ovals, gymnasium and a variety of sporting clubs and activities.
All other campuses are located close to great community sports facilities.
On-Campus Sports Facilities and Services
Melbourne (Bundoora)
The Sports Centre has a fully equipped gym, squash/racquetball and tennis courts, volleyball, badminton, indoor soccer, netball and basketball courts, a 25-metre pool with deep water pit, dance and yoga studios.
The centre also offers group exercise classes, dance classes, pilates and yoga. They can also arrange tuition in most sports and the hiring out of courts to students at discounted rates. The Centre also offers deep tissue and trigger point sports massage.

Bendigo
At our Bendigo campus, the Evolution Sports and Fitness Centre offers discount rates for students. Facilities include a sports hall, weight room and gymnasium. The BSA (Bendigo Student Association) organise activities in an extraordinary range of sports!

Off-Campus Sports Facilities
La Trobe has some great facilities available off-campus including use of a ski lodge in Mount Buller’s alpine village; a synthetic hockey pitch in Reservoir; and Rowing Club members have access to the boat sheds on the Yarra River, Melbourne. Contact the Sports Centre for more information

Intervarsity Games
The Australian University Games (AUGs) give students from Australian universities the chance to compete against each other in a variety of sports. In 2005 and 2006, athletes from La Trobe won medals at the games held in Brisbane.

Team Melbourne
La Trobe University is proud to be in partnership with Team Melbourne, an alliance of Melbourne’s premier sporting clubs.
Team Melbourne is dedicated to providing a gateway to Melbourne’s premier sporting clubs, assisting in the grass roots development of sport in Victoria and providing educational and career development opportunities for athletes, staff and students.
